Subject: [PATCH] flow_offload: add control flag checking helpers
|
||||
MIME-Version: 1.0
|
||||
Content-Type: text/plain; charset=UTF-8
|
||||
Content-Transfer-Encoding: 8bit
|
||||
|
||||
These helpers aim to help drivers, with checking
|
||||
for the presence of unsupported control flags.
|
||||
|
||||
For drivers supporting at least one control flag:
|
||||
flow_rule_is_supp_control_flags()
|
||||
|
||||
For drivers using flow_rule_match_control(), but not using flags:
|
||||
flow_rule_has_control_flags()
|
||||
|
||||
For drivers not using flow_rule_match_control():
|
||||
flow_rule_match_has_control_flags()
|
||||
|
||||
While primarily aimed at FLOW_DISSECTOR_KEY_CONTROL
|
||||
and flow_rule_match_control(), then the first two
|
||||
can also be used with FLOW_DISSECTOR_KEY_ENC_CONTROL
|
||||
and flow_rule_match_enc_control().
|
||||
|
||||
These helpers mirrors the existing check done in sfc:
|
||||
drivers/net/ethernet/sfc/tc.c +276
|
||||
|
||||
Only compile-tested.

Subject: [PATCH] ipv6: Add ipv6_addr_{cpu_to_be32,be32_to_cpu} helpers
|
||||
|
||||
Add helpers to convert an ipv6 addr, expressed as an array
|
||||
of words, from CPU to big-endian byte order, and vice versa.
|
||||
|
||||
No functional change intended.

Subject: [PATCH] netdevice: add netdev_tx_reset_subqueue() shorthand
|
||||
|
||||
Add a shorthand similar to other net*_subqueue() helpers for resetting
|
||||
the queue by its index w/o obtaining &netdev_tx_queue beforehand
|
||||
manually.
